Description

LNP COLORCOMP G1000 is an unfilled Polysulfone (PSU) resin. Added feature of this grade is: Transparent.

Technological properties

Property
Application areas

Medical Device, Surgical Devices

Availability

Europe,Asia,Americas

Processing methods

Drying Temperature: 120 to 150.0°C
Drying Time: 4hrs
Maximum Moisture Content: 0.05%
Melt Temperature: 360 to 370.0°C
Front - Zone 3 Temperature: 350 to 360.0°C
Middle - Zone 2 Temperature: 340 to 350.0°C
Rear - Zone 1 Temperature: 325 to 340.0°C
Mold Temperature: 150°C
Back Pressure: 0.2 to 0.3MPa
Screw Speed: 30 to 60.0rpm
